R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CHULA
VISTA REVISING COUNCIL POLICY 159-02 "FUNDING-PRIVATE
ORGANIZATIONS OR INDIVIDUALS"
WHEREAS, Council Policy 159-02, "Funding-Private Organizations or Individuals", was
adopted by Council on January 25, 1972; and,
WHEREAS, this policy addresses the criteria, procedures and requirements for funding
private parties via the budget process; and,
WHEREAS, the existing policy is lacking in that it does not address requests received
during the course of a fiscal year, from private organizations and individuals, for financial
support to carry out program or activities; and,
WHEREAS, Council has directed staff to develop policy guidelines to assist them in
consideration of such requests; and,
WHEREAS, in response to that directire, staff proposes the attached policy revisions.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ED the City Council of the City of Chula
Vista does hereby revise Council Policy 159-02 "Funding-Private Organizations or Individuals"
as set forth in Attachment A, att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ference as if set
forth in full.

BACI(GROUND
The City Coundl receives requests from private organizations and individuals for finandal support to carry out
programs or activities. When these programs or activities are deemed to be beneficial to the interests of the
citizens of the City of Chula Vista, they constitute a munidpal purpose for which the expenditure of public
funds is allowed. The City Council has adopted the following policy to assist private organizations or
individuals in requesting such funds and Council in considering requests for said funding.
1. To establish guidelines and criteria for providing public financial support to private organizations or
individuals.
2. To establish procedures for processing and administering requests for ftmding from private
organizations or individuals via the budget process.
3. To establish policies and procedures for consideration of requests for funding by private organizations
or individuals submitted outside of the budget process.
SCOPE
1. This policy applies to all requests for non-Community Development Block Grant (CDBG} funding by
private organziations or individuals.
Organi?~fions The functions or services to be performed with the funding requested must be such
that the interests of the City are better served by an agreement arrangement with a private
organization than by performance of the services or functions by the City or is such that the purpose
of or reason for support serves a specific tangible benefit to the City.
Individuals Financial support of individuals shall not be approved unless the purpose of or reason for
suppo~ serves a specific tangible benefit to the City.

Financial suppor~ granted outside of the budget process shall be the lesser of $500 or the value of the
tangible benefit to be received by the City through funding of the program or activity or through
services to be received in exchange for said funding. Council may deem, by three affirmative votes, to
exceed the $500 limit if the value of the benefit is determined to exceed $500 and therefore an
expenditure of a greater amount is appropriate.
pRO(~-F}URES
Requests for Funding
Requests for funding via the Coramuaity Promotions Prograin Budget Process. Except for emergency
or unanticipated funding requirements, all funding requests shall be made in this manner.
Requests for funding shah be submiRed to the City Manager's office on or before the last Monday in
the month of February of each year and must be accompanied by: a detailed operating budget
showing all sources of revenues for operations and the nature of all proposed expenditures by objea;
an audited financial statement, if available, covering the organization's last complete fiscal year
relating actual revenues and expenditures to the budget estimates for that year and indicating any
operating surplus or deficit; and a statement outlining the proposed program for the year for which
support is being requested.
Requests for funding by organiTations or individuals outside of the budget process. Occasionally a
situation arises where it is not possible to anticipate the need for funding assistance within the
timeframe for budget consideration. Under these circumstances requests for funding shall be made in
the following manner:
a. Requests for funding shah be submitted, in writing, to the City Council via the City Clerk
These requests shah include a statement regarding the nature and purpose of all proposed
expenditures and the "specific tangible" benefit to be derived by the community through
funding of said activity(ies).
b. Requests for funding shah be referred to the City Manager for analysis and recommendation.
The City Manager will review requests in the light of the contribution to the service rendered
by the organization/individual towards the achievement of community goals and the City's
current fiscal status.
All requests for funding must be accompanied by a written declaration, signed by a responsible officer
of the organization or by the individual making the request stating that said organization or

Dism'bution of Funds
No expenditure may be made out of any appropriation until a written agreement setting out the terms
and obligations of the parties has been entered into. The agreement will specify, in detail, the
services or functions to be performed, the nature of the reimbursement schedule and financial
reporting requirements.
All agreements will provide that any organization/individual receiving financial support from the City
agrees that the City will be permitted to inspect all books and records of the private
organization/individual and to perform audits the City reasonably desires.
All agreements will provide for the City to withhold funds from the organization/individual and to
terminate its entire obligation upon notice to the organization/individual if the
organization/individual violates any of the terms of the agreement or for other good cause shown not
related to a violation of the agreement. The City Manager shah thereafter notify the City Council of
the notification of termination made to the organization/individual.
